Acceptance statement by Al-Haj Hasnain Walji, the President of the World Federation


In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ful.

Yaa Rabbi, Yaa Rabbi, Yaa Rabbi, Qawwi Alaa Khidmatika Jawarihii.

O my Lord, O my Lord, O my Lord, strengthen my limbs in your service.

(Dua e Kumayl).

Aware of the magnitude of the responsibility and cognizant of my own limitations, I seek the Grace and Blessings of Allah (SWT) through the wasila of Masumeen (A.S) as we begin preparations to embark on this voyage on the sea of service. I thank you, one and all, for your confidence and an overwhelming mandate. I hereby pledge to serve the Community to the best of my ability, as the President of the World Federation of KSI Muslim Communities, and seek your prayers and continued support to enable me to justify the trust and confidence placed upon me by the Community around the globe.

In engaging in the electoral process, once again, our Community has conducted itself well by its dignity, discipline, and maturity. At this juncture, I would like to express my sincere appreciation to Alhajj Mohamedbhai Dhirani for his message of support and good wishes and reciprocate by acknowledging his long-standing services and have every confidence that he will continue in his endeavours to serve and guide in the best interest of the Community. 

Now that the people have spoken, I pray, that together, with a unity of purpose, we can all move in unison in attaining the aims of the World Federation and enhancing the services of this august institution thereby earning the pleasure of Allah (SWT). As enumerated in my vision statement, the task ahead for the WF is to continue to strive to provide the same level services it has rendered in the past and at the same time rise to meet the new challenges that face us in the days to come. Under Marhum Mulla Saheb’s exemplary leadership much has been accomplished, we have the infrastructure in place and now we must seize the opportunity to make even greater strides in the service of Imame Zamana (AS), by building upon the infrastructure and actualising the potential of the young faithful by giving them more and more opportunities to serve and eventually lead. 

In this day and age of globalisation, more than ever before, I see the WF as an enabler and facilitator in all our endeavours towards the betterment of our community. To that end, I pledge to engender team spirit, cultivate consensus and redouble efforts to foster even better coordination amongst all our institutions across the globe, in the service of the community.  In turn I earnestly request a reciprocal commitment from our Jamaats, Regional Organizations and other institutions. Therein, I believe, lies a potent force of unity and progress.

Together let us make this 9th term starting in October 2000, a term of introspection, reflection and deliberations. I invite the leaders, thinkers, well wishers and workers of the community from all corners of the globe to come together to make it a term of consolidation as much as one of beneficial innovations and progress, Inshallah.
